Code P2716 Description

The diagnostic trouble code P2716 indicates an issue with the Pressure Control Solenoid 'D' in the transmission system of a vehicle. The pressure control solenoid is responsible for regulating the hydraulic pressure in the transmission, which is crucial for smooth gear shifting and overall transmission performance. When this solenoid experiences electrical problems, it can lead to various issues with the transmission system.

Common Causes of P2716

  1. Faulty pressure control solenoid 'D'
  2. Damaged or corroded wiring in the solenoid circuit
  3. Poor electrical connections
  4. Issues with the transmission control module
  5. Low transmission fluid levels or contaminated fluid

Symptoms of P2716

  1. Erratic or harsh shifting
  2. Transmission slipping
  3. Transmission going into limp mode
  4. Delayed engagement when shifting gears
  5. Illuminated Check Engine Light

How to Fix P2716

  1. Begin by diagnosing the specific cause of the P2716 code using a scan tool to pinpoint the exact issue with the pressure control solenoid 'D'.
  2. Inspect the wiring and electrical connections associated with the solenoid for any damage or corrosion. Repair or replace as necessary.
  3. Test the pressure control solenoid 'D' to determine if it is functioning correctly. Replace the solenoid if it is found to be faulty.
  4. Clear the trouble code from the vehicle's computer using the scan tool after completing the repairs.
  5. Test drive the vehicle to ensure that the transmission is shifting smoothly and that the issue has been resolved.

Cost to Fix P2716

The typical repair costs for addressing the P2716 code can vary depending on the specific cause of the issue and the vehicle's make and model. In general, replacing a pressure control solenoid 'D' can cost between $150 and $400, including parts and labor. Additional costs may apply if there are other underlying issues that need to be addressed.
